3 Mistakes to Avoid When Using Bathroom Tiles
When it comes to a bathroom remodel, tiles are almost always going to be a feature. They are versatile, can be used on all different kinds of surfaces, and are ideal for a wet environment. Although bathroom tiling is very popular, this is not to say that everybody gets their use of tile correct. Here are some mistakes to avoid when utilising tile in your bathroom remodel.
Too much variety. The bathroom tends to be one of the smaller rooms in the house and for this reason lends itself to unfussy, uncomplicated design choices. Yes, there's a huge number of great tile designs out there, but this doesn't mean that you can accommodate all of your favourite tiles into one bathroom remodel. You should, as a rule, not use more than three types of tile in one bathroom (unless it's very large), and they should complement each other in terms of colour and pattern. Stick to three and under and your bathroom will look far more chic.
Choosing the wrong grout. So much effort goes into choosing bathroom tiles, yet relatively little goes into picking grout colours, and grout is going to be something visible in any bathroom with tile and thus deserves just as much attention. First of all, you need to decide if you want the colour of the grout to pop or if you want it to be more seamless and harmonious with the colour of the tile. For most smaller bathrooms, a grout colour similar to that of the tile would be best. But even with a small bathroom, you could make a feature of one part of the bathroom by choosing a contrasting grout colour.
Using too many cut tiles. Cut tiles can create an interesting effect, but this should be limited to very small areas of the bathroom. Since cut tiles are very eye-catching, people who like to make a bold statement with design tend to utilise them. However, though bold can certainly be a good thing, the messy look of lots of cut tiles will simply be too much for the eye to handle. Even when you are cutting tiles to meet the edge of a floor or wall, try to cut them to over half the tiles' size because skinny tiles can look very jarring.
